Why Do My Pipes Make Noises
To diagnose loud plumbing, it is important to identify initial whether the unwanted audios occur on the system's inlet side-in various other words, when water is transformed on-or on the drain side. Sounds on the inlet side have differed causes: too much water pressure, worn shutoff and tap components, poorly connected pumps or various other devices, incorrectly positioned pipe fasteners, as well as plumbing runs containing too many tight bends or various other restrictions. Noises on the drainpipe side usually come from poor place or, similar to some inlet side noise, a design having tight bends.

Hissing


Hissing sound that occurs when a faucet is opened somewhat usually signals extreme water stress. Consult your local water company if you suspect this problem; it will certainly be able to tell you the water stress in your area as well as can mount a pressurereducing valve on the incoming water pipe if required.

Various Other Inlet Side Noises


Creaking, squeaking, damaging, breaking, and also tapping normally are brought on by the expansion or tightening of pipelines, generally copper ones providing hot water. The audios occur as the pipes slide versus loosened bolts or strike nearby residence framing. You can typically identify the area of the trouble if the pipes are subjected; just follow the sound when the pipes are making noise. Most likely you will discover a loose pipe hanger or an area where pipelines exist so near flooring joists or various other mounting items that they clatter versus them. Attaching foam pipe insulation around the pipes at the point of contact should remedy the problem. Be sure straps as well as hangers are protected as well as offer sufficient support. Where possible, pipeline bolts must be connected to large architectural aspects such as structure wall surfaces rather than to framing; doing so lessens the transmission of vibrations from plumbing to surface areas that can intensify as well as transfer them. If attaching bolts to framing is inescapable, cover pipelines with insulation or other resilient product where they call fasteners, and sandwich completions of brand-new fasteners between rubber washing machines when installing them.
Correcting plumbing runs that experience flow-restricting tight or various bends is a last resort that needs to be embarked on only after getting in touch with a skilled plumbing service provider. Regrettably, this circumstance is fairly common in older residences that might not have been built with indoor plumbing or that have actually seen a number of remodels, particularly by amateurs.

Babbling or Shrilling


Extreme chattering or shrilling that happens when a valve or tap is switched on, and that usually goes away when the installation is opened totally, signals loose or malfunctioning inner components. The option is to replace the valve or tap with a brand-new one.
Pumps as well as appliances such as washing devices and dishwashers can move electric motor noise to pipelines if they are poorly linked. Link such items to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drain Noise


On the drainpipe side of plumbing, the chief objectives are to get rid of surfaces that can be struck by dropping or rushing water and also to protect pipelines to consist of inevitable sounds.
In brand-new construction, bath tubs, shower stalls, bathrooms, and also wallmounted sinks and containers should be set on or versus resilient underlayments to lower the transmission of sound via them. Water-saving toilets and also taps are much less noisy than standard designs; mount them instead of older kinds even if codes in your area still allow using older components.
Drainpipes that do not run vertically to the cellar or that branch into straight pipeline runs supported at flooring joists or other mounting present especially bothersome sound issues. Such pipes are huge sufficient to emit substantial resonance; they additionally carry substantial amounts of water, which makes the scenario worse. In new building and construction, specify cast-iron soil pipelines (the large pipes that drain commodes) if you can afford them. Their enormity contains a lot of the sound made by water passing through them. Likewise, prevent transmitting drainpipes in walls shown rooms and spaces where individuals collect. Wall surfaces containing drainpipes ought to be soundproofed as was explained previously, utilizing dual panels of sound-insulating fiber board and also wallboard. Pipelines themselves can be covered with unique fiberglass insulation created the purpose; such pipes have a resistant plastic skin (occasionally consisting of lead). Outcomes are not always adequate.

Thudding


Thudding sound, commonly accompanied by trembling pipes, when a faucet or device shutoff is shut off is a condition called water hammer. The sound and also resonance are triggered by the reverberating wave of stress in the water, which instantly has no location to go. Often opening up a shutoff that discharges water quickly right into an area of piping including a restriction, elbow, or tee installation can create the exact same condition.
Water hammer can generally be healed by installing installations called air chambers or shock absorbers in the plumbing to which the problem shutoffs or faucets are attached. These gadgets allow the shock wave developed by the halted flow of water to dissipate in the air they contain, which (unlike water) is compressible.
Older plumbing systems might have short upright sections of capped pipeline behind walls on tap competes the exact same purpose; these can ultimately fill with water, decreasing or damaging their efficiency. The treatment is to drain the water supply completely by shutting down the main water system shutoff as well as opening all taps. Then open up the major supply valve as well as shut the faucets one by one, beginning with the tap nearest the valve and finishing with the one farthest away.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
